President Donald Trump threatened to impose a 200% tariff on wine, champagne, and other alcoholic beverages from France and the European Union. The threat is in response to the EU’s plan to impose a tax on American whiskey exports, which is a retaliation against Trump’s steel and aluminum tariffs. Trump’s tariff threat has caused shares in European makers of alcoholic beverages to fall, and has escalated the transatlantic trade war. Bloomberg News Albertina Torsoli reports.
